The increased use of OAT has led to the development of point-of-care (POC) portable monitoring devices designed to use a capillary sample of whole blood for PT determination. Prothrombin time test results can vary widely depending on the method of clot detection and the thromboplastin reagent used. ...

In the MSUD state, elevated levels of leucine (Leu), isoleucine (Ile), valine (Val), and alloiso-leucine can be detected in blood. The increased concentration of the branched-chain amino acids is caused by an inherited deficient activity of the enzyme branched-chain keto-acid decarboxylase. ...
